Re: Hotswapping batteries - MacBook Pro...

2007-04-30 Thread James Devenish
Hi Rob, There are at least a couple features at work since the PowerBook days. Firstly, 'sleep' basically only needs power for its power management unit, Bluetooth (optional), USB bus and RAM. This is done by the mains adaptor, the main battery, or a small internal battery that lasts about 3
